Enloe's career night lifts Texans to victory over Southwest in F&M Bank Tip-Off Classic

STEPHENVILLE – Preston Enloe scored a career-high 20 points – including 15 in the second half – to carry Tarleton to an 83-70 victory over Southwest (N.M.) in the final game of the F&M Bank Tip-Off Classic in Wisdom Gym.
 
The Texans (3-1) started off slow offensively in the first half, scoring only 30 points in the first twenty minutes to lead by three at the break.
 
Tarleton led by one with 12:18 left in the game when the offense caught fire from outside as the Texans went on a 7-0 run to go up 56-48. Enloe drilled three straight 3-pointers for a double-digit Texan lead at 67-57. The Texans stayed with the long ball as Josh Hawley, Randall Broddie and Enloe hit three straight threes for a game-high 17-point lead at 76-59 with 4:12 to go.
 
The Texans shot 10-15 from 3-pointers in the second half, and went 14-27 for the game. Enloe made six 3-pointers, while Randall Broddie scored all 12 of his points from behind the arc and Hawley drained a pair of 3's
 
Enloe wasn't the only Texan to have a big second-half performance as Hawley scored all 16 of his points in the final frame to go with six rebounds. Richie Mitchell came off the bench and scored eight points and dished out seven assists in the second half as well.
 
The Texans finished the game shooting 54 percent from the field and 51 percent on 3-pointers.
 
Clashon Gaffney (8 points, 7 rebounds) and Jesse Hill (7 points, 8 rebounds) provided a spark down low off the bench. Corinthian Ramsey added six points and four assists, while Jaraan Lands and Isaiah Boling each scored three points to round out the Texan scoring efforts.
 
Tarleton will stay at home to take on Jarvis Christian on Wednesday, Nov. 15 at 7 p.m. in Wisdom Gym.
